Begin your journey into wine with the WSET Level 1 Award. Perfect for beginners, this course provides a hands-on introduction to the world of wine. Explore the main types and styles of wine through sight, smell, and taste while developing your descriptive vocabulary using the WSET Level 1 Systematic Approach to Tasting Wine® (SAT).
You will gain foundational knowledge in wine production, storage and service, and food and wine pairing principles. Upon successful completion, you'll receive a WSET certificate and lapel pin.
Course Features
- Tasting samples included, meeting qualification requirements
- Assessment: Closed-book exam with 30 multiple-choice questions
- Resit available for a $120 fee if not successful
- No prior entry requirements, but participants must be of legal drinking age for tastings

William Angliss Institute is Australia's largest specialist centre for foods, tourism, hospitality and events education and training. From careers in restaurants to leading some of the world's biggest travel brands, you'll find our graduates all over the world.
We pride ourselves on our people who are passionate and dedicated. With long-standing industry ties, they contribute their knowledge and experience in delivering training of the very highest standard.
Highlighting our deep industry connections, 86.3% of employers stated that they would recommend William Angliss Institute (William Angliss Institute of TAFE (3045) 2020 RTO Performance Summary Report, Department of Education and Training, Victoria 2020).
Named Large Training Provider of the Year at the 2021 Australian Training Awards our position as a leader in education has been long standing, building on over 85 years of experience.
We provide training for local and international students based on campus or participating in workplace training. With around 23,000 students enrolling each year, we offer programs including short courses, VET in Schools, accredited traineeships and apprenticeships, certificates, diplomas and advanced diplomas, short courses, graduate certificates, bachelor and master degrees. If you're looking to start your career or advance your position, we have training to suit your needs.
Our main campus in the heart of Melbourne is complemented by a campus in Sydney and offices in Brisbane, Adelaide and Perth, servicing both metropolitan and regional areas across the country and in every state and territory in Australia.
Internationally we continue to develop program offerings with four joint-venture campuses in China, a Tourism Continuing Education & Training (CET) Centre in Singapore, a partnership in Sri Lanka and two partnerships and a representative office in Vietnam.
